Abstract

Given a skeleton knowledge graph including first terms in respective nodes, wherein first terms in connected nodes have a predetermined relationship, an augmented knowledge graph is formed by a first computing device by extracting a second term from a domain corpus to form a term cluster linked with a respective node of the knowledge graph. The second term is associated with the first term of a respective node in the domain corpus while not meeting the predetermined relationship. A semantic feature between the second term and the associated first term is identified in the domain corpus and linked to the pair of the second term and the first term in the augmented knowledge graph. The augmented knowledge graph is useable by a second computing device, which may or may not be the same as the first computing device, to drive a conversation between a chatbot and user.
